Florida enforces some of the most stringent pool safety laws in the country to help prevent child drownings and protect families. In Fort Myers, where backyard pools are common and the tropical climate keeps swimming season going nearly year-round, these safety laws are critical. Installing a pool safety fence in Fort Myers ensures your pool area complies with both state and Lee County regulations, while providing a secure, worry-free environment for children, pets, and guests.
“According to National Institutes of Health, Drowning is the 2nd or 3rd leading cause of unintentional injury deaths among children under 15 in industrialized countries, with children under 5 facing the highest risk. In the U.S., the drowning rate for children under 5 is 3.9 per 100,000. Installing pool fencing reduces the risk of drowning by approximately 73%.”

Florida law requires all residential swimming pools to be enclosed with approved safety barriers to reduce the risk of accidental drownings—particularly for children under six.
